Damp Walls and Ceiling Stains in Dubai — Reading the Signs and Finding the Real Source

A brown ring on a white ceiling or a damp patch spreading across a plastered wall is one of those problems that is easy to notice and surprisingly difficult to trace. The visible stain is rarely where the water is actually entering the structure. Water follows the path of least resistance through concrete, along rebars, and across pipe sleeves — it can travel several metres horizontally or vertically through a slab before appearing on a surface. This is why the obvious approach of opening the wall or ceiling at the stain location so often fails to find the source.

In Dubai’s mix of villa properties, apartment towers, and older concrete construction, damp walls and ceiling stains can come from four distinct sources that require completely different repairs. Identifying which source you are dealing with before anything is opened up saves significant time, money, and unnecessary demolition.


The Four Sources of Damp Walls and Ceiling Stains in Dubai Properties

1. Plumbing Pipe Failures

Supply pipe leaks — from a joint failure, a pinhole in corroded pipe, or a cracked fitting — introduce pressurised water into the wall or slab continuously. The water enters the concrete and travels until it finds a low-resistance exit path, which is usually the nearest wall surface, a slab edge, or a ceiling below.

The characteristics that distinguish a plumbing leak stain: it tends to grow slowly over days and weeks, it appears or worsens regardless of rainfall or AC use, and it often correlates with a DEWA consumption increase that has no other explanation. The stain from a supply pipe leak is typically active — cool and slightly damp to the touch if you press the plaster surface.

In Dubai villas built before 2012, the most common plumbing source is a slow joint failure on an in-slab supply line. The pipe itself is often still intact; the compression fitting or solvent-welded joint at a bend has opened slightly over years of pressure cycling and thermal expansion. Water exits at that point and enters the slab. The surface manifestation — a damp patch on the ground floor tile or a lower wall section — may be a metre or more from the actual joint failure.

2. AC System Condensation and Drain Failures

This is the most frequently misdiagnosed source of ceiling stains in Dubai apartments. Air conditioning systems remove humidity from indoor air, and the condensed moisture drains away through a drain line. When that drain line becomes blocked — by dust, algae, or debris — the condensate pan overflows. The overflow water drains into the ceiling void and eventually stains the gypsum ceiling below.

A second AC-related cause is failed insulation on chilled water pipes. Where the foam insulation on a chilled water pipe has deteriorated, the pipe surface reaches its dew point and condensation forms on the exterior of the pipe. This drips off the pipe and onto whatever is below it in the ceiling void — often the plasterboard ceiling of the room below.

The identifying characteristic of an AC stain: it typically appears in a circular or elongated pattern directly below AC equipment or ceiling voids where chilled water pipes run, and it worsens during periods of heavy cooling use — typically the Dubai summer months. Switching off the AC system for 48 hours and watching whether the stain progresses or stops is a reliable first test.

3. Roof and Terrace Waterproofing Failure

Dubai receives relatively little rainfall, but when it does rain — particularly in the increasingly heavy rain events the region has seen in recent years — any failure in roof or terrace waterproofing is immediately exposed. Water pools on flat roofs and terraces and finds any path through the membrane: aged sealant at drain outlets, cracked surface coatings at parapet junctions, or deteriorated flashings at any penetration point.

Roof waterproofing stains appear specifically during or after rain events and are typically more diffuse than pipe leak stains — they cover broader ceiling areas and often affect multiple rooms. In Dubai villa construction, the concrete roof slab is covered by a waterproofing membrane that has a finite service life. Properties built in the early 2000s frequently have membranes that are past this service life and produce ceiling stains every time significant rain occurs.

4. Inter-Floor Bathroom Leaks in Apartments

In multi-storey buildings, bathroom wet area waterproofing failures in an upper unit produce ceiling stains in the unit below. The mechanism is simple: the waterproofing membrane beneath the bathroom tiles of the unit above has aged or been compromised, and shower water seeps through the tile grout, through the failed membrane, and into the concrete slab. It exits on the ceiling surface of the unit below.

The identifying characteristic: the ceiling stain appears or worsens after the upper unit’s bathroom is used. It often has a soft, spreading edge rather than a hard ring and may appear directly below the bathroom or slightly offset depending on how the water has travelled through the slab. The unit above may have no visible water in their bathroom — the failure is below their tiles and they are unaware of it.


How to Read the Stain Pattern Before Calling Anyone

Before booking an inspection, these observations narrow the diagnosis significantly:

  • When does it appear or worsen? Only after rain — roof or terrace. Only after shower use in the unit above — inter-floor bathroom leak. Continuously regardless of weather or bathroom use — plumbing pipe failure. Gets worse in summer during heavy AC use — condensation.
  • Where is it located? Directly below a bathroom — bathroom slab waterproofing. Near or below AC equipment or ductwork — AC system. Across broad ceiling areas — roof leak. On a lower wall section near the floor — in-slab supply pipe or rising damp.
  • Is it growing? Trace the edge of the stain with a pencil and check in 24 hours. An active source produces a stain that is still expanding. A resolved or intermittent source produces a stain with no change over days.
  • Water meter test: Isolate all water-using fixtures and appliances and check if the water meter moves. If it does, there is an active plumbing leak somewhere in the system, regardless of what the stain pattern looks like.

Why the Stain Is Never Where the Leak Is

Concrete is porous. Water introduced into it under pressure or by gravity follows the aggregate structure of the concrete, moving along the path of least resistance — which is almost never straight down. It can travel horizontally through a slab for significant distances before finding a surface to exit from. This is reinforced by rebar runs: water tracks along the surface of steel reinforcement bars, which can be oriented in any direction through the slab.

This is why opening the ceiling at the stain location reliably fails to find the source. The plaster may be wet, but the pipe that is leaking is somewhere else. Professional leak detection uses the stain as a starting point to map where the moisture has travelled, then traces it backward to the origin.

The Damage That Accumulates While the Source Goes Unfound

Moisture inside a wall or slab does not evaporate on its own. It sits in the concrete and creates conditions for two progressive damage mechanisms. First, the moisture reacts with the steel reinforcement inside the concrete slab. The rebar corrodes, and the corrosion product occupies greater volume than the original steel — the expanding rust cracks the surrounding concrete from the inside. This is concrete spalling, and it compromises the structural integrity of the slab over time.

Second, persistent moisture in wall cavities and ceiling voids creates ideal conditions for mold. Dubai’s warm temperatures mean mold can establish within 24 to 48 hours of sufficient moisture. It grows on the back of plasterboard, on timber framing, and on any organic material in the wall cavity — all invisible until the wall is opened or until it has grown large enough to produce a musty odour that enters the living space.


Detection Methods — What Professional Inspection Involves

Plumber Dubai uses three primary tools for damp wall and ceiling stain investigation, applied in sequence depending on what the initial assessment suggests:

Thermal imaging: A thermal camera scans wall and ceiling surfaces and detects temperature variations. Moisture in a material changes its thermal properties — wet areas appear as cooler zones on the camera display against the warmer surrounding dry material. Thermal imaging is fast and non-destructive, covering large surface areas quickly to identify the zones of highest moisture concentration.

Acoustic detection: For suspected pressurised pipe leaks, acoustic sensors placed against wall and floor surfaces amplify the sound of water escaping from a pipe under pressure. The sensor is moved systematically toward the point of highest signal, locating the pipe failure to within a few centimetres. This is how slab leaks and in-wall pipe failures are located without demolishing the entire surface.

Moisture meters: Digital moisture meters measure the water content inside a material at specific points, allowing the technician to map moisture levels across a wall or ceiling and distinguish between active wetness and old dried staining. A metre that reads high moisture at a specific point in an otherwise dry wall section identifies the moisture pathway.

After detection, a written report documents the findings — the moisture source, its location, the extent of moisture spread, and the recommended repair. This report is standard on every job and is required for insurance claims and building management inter-floor leak disputes.

What to Do Before the Plumber Arrives

If you have a visible active leak or a ceiling that is bulging with trapped water:

  • Close the main water supply valve to stop any plumbing source immediately
  • Move furniture, electronics, and rugs away from the affected area
  • Place buckets under active drips and towels against damp wall sections
  • If the ceiling is visibly bulging, carefully make a small hole at the lowest point of the bulge with a screwdriver to release the trapped water in a controlled way rather than allowing the ceiling to collapse under its own weight
  • Do not operate electrical switches in any room where water is on the floor or dripping from the ceiling
  • Open windows to promote air circulation and slow mold establishment

The Response Structure That Makes the Difference in Moisture Damage

Moisture damage compounds with time. A ceiling stain that has been present for two weeks and was investigated and fixed promptly means repainting a small section. The same stain left for two months while the source goes unfound means replastering, potential rebar treatment, and mold remediation. The speed of the investigation matters as much as the quality of it.

FAQs — Damp Walls and Ceiling Stains in Dubai

How do I tell if a ceiling stain is from an active leak or an old one that has dried?

An active stain is cool or slightly damp to the touch and often has a darker centre. Trace the edge with a pencil and recheck in 24 hours — if the boundary has moved, the source is still running. A moisture meter confirms definitively whether the surrounding material is actively wet or dry residue. Old stains dry to a yellow-brown ring with no detectable moisture in the plaster around them.

Can AC condensation cause ceiling stains in Dubai apartments?

Yes, and it is among the most common causes. A blocked condensate drain line overflows into the ceiling void. Failed pipe insulation on chilled water lines causes surface condensation that drips onto the ceiling below. Both produce stains that worsen during heavy AC use — the summer months — rather than after rain or bathroom use. Switching off the AC system for 48 hours and monitoring whether the stain progresses is a useful first test.

My ceiling is staining but the apartment above has no visible leak — who is responsible?

Water in concrete slabs travels along aggregate and rebar paths before finding a surface exit. The unit above may have a failed bathroom waterproofing membrane with no visible surface leak in their space. A professional thermal imaging and moisture mapping inspection traces the water path back to its origin. Building management involvement is standard for inter-floor disputes, and a written inspection report is the document that resolves them.

Will the stain disappear once the leak is fixed?

No. Water leaves mineral deposits and sometimes mold residue in the plaster that do not disappear as the area dries. After the leak is fixed and the area has fully dried, a stain-blocking primer is required before repainting — painting directly over a water stain causes it to bleed through new paint within weeks. If mold was present, the affected plaster section should be removed rather than painted over.

Does high humidity alone cause damp walls in Dubai?

High humidity causes even surface condensation on cold surfaces — exterior walls, window frames — but not concentrated patches with defined edges. A localised stain with a clear boundary is almost always from a specific water source rather than ambient humidity. Surface condensation from humidity is more common in winter when indoor and outdoor temperatures diverge most; plumbing and AC-related stains occur year-round.
